Client Development & Communications Specialist
London | 14-Month Fixed-Term Contract (Maternity Cover)
Are you a commercially minded marketing and business development professional looking for a role where no two days are the same? We're looking for an experienced Client Development & Communications Specialist to join a high-performing marketing team within a leading international professional services firm.
This is an exciting opportunity to work at the heart of business development, communications, digital marketing, PR, and events, partnering with senior stakeholders to deliver strategic initiatives that strengthen client relationships and support business growth.
What You'll Be Doing
You'll play a key role in delivering high-impact marketing and business development activity, including:
- Leading and supporting strategic go-to-market initiatives and practice group plans.
- Creating compelling pitches, proposals, presentations, and client-facing materials.
- Managing communications and PR campaigns in collaboration with external agencies.
- Planning and delivering webinars, client events, sponsorships, and networking opportunities.
- Coordinating client alerts, website content, lawyer biographies, and digital communications.
- Conducting market, client, and competitor research to identify business opportunities.
- Supporting lateral partner integration and business development initiatives.
- Managing legal directory submissions, tracking marketing metrics, and reporting on campaign performance.
- Collaborating with colleagues across marketing, communications, digital, and leadership teams to deliver outstanding results.
What You'll Bring
We're looking for someone who combines commercial awareness with excellent organisational and communication skills.
You'll ideally have:
- 5+ years' experience in marketing or business development within a law firm or professional services environment.
- Strong experience producing pitches, proposals, events, and communications.
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ills with exceptional attention to detail.
- Confidence working with senior stakeholders and building trusted relationships.
- The ability to manage multiple projects, balance competing priorities, and meet tight deadlines.
- Strong Microsoft Office skills, particularly PowerPoint, Word, and Excel. Experience with CRM and marketing platforms is advantageous.
